Login/Register
Concerts & Events
Festivals
The Week In Live
LNSource
VIP Tickets
As seen at Download Festival
As seen at Glastonbury
Hovarda Canary Wharf
5 Water St, London, United Kingdom, E14 5GX
Events
No events on sale
Share